Fix crash related to AnimatedBlocks
This commit is contained in:
parent
8a39146e3e
commit
bc4e42d1f3
|
@ -69,13 +69,14 @@
|
|||
If BlockTexturesTemp.ContainsKey(AnimationNames(n) & "_0") = False Then
|
||||
For i = 0 To Me.rows(n) - 1
|
||||
For j = 0 To Me.columns(n) - 1
|
||||
If SeasonColorTexture <> "" Then
|
||||
CurrentSeason = P3D.World.CurrentSeason
|
||||
BlockTexturesTemp.Add(AnimationNames(n) & "_" & (j + columns(n) * i).ToString, P3D.World.GetSeasonTexture(TextureManager.GetTexture("Textures\Seasons\" & Me.SeasonColorTexture), TextureManager.GetTexture(AdditionalValue, New Rectangle(r.X + r.Width * j, r.Y + r.Height * i, r.Width, r.Height))))
|
||||
Else
|
||||
BlockTexturesTemp.Add(AnimationNames(n) & "_" & (j + columns(n) * i).ToString, TextureManager.GetTexture(AdditionalValue, New Rectangle(r.X + r.Width * j, r.Y + r.Height * i, r.Width, r.Height)))
|
||||
If BlockTexturesTemp.ContainsKey(AnimationNames(n) & "_" & (j + columns(n) * i).ToString) = False Then
|
||||
If SeasonColorTexture <> "" Then
|
||||
CurrentSeason = P3D.World.CurrentSeason
|
||||
BlockTexturesTemp.Add(AnimationNames(n) & "_" & (j + columns(n) * i).ToString, P3D.World.GetSeasonTexture(TextureManager.GetTexture("Textures\Seasons\" & Me.SeasonColorTexture), TextureManager.GetTexture(AdditionalValue, New Rectangle(r.X + r.Width * j, r.Y + r.Height * i, r.Width, r.Height))))
|
||||
Else
|
||||
BlockTexturesTemp.Add(AnimationNames(n) & "_" & (j + columns(n) * i).ToString, TextureManager.GetTexture(AdditionalValue, New Rectangle(r.X + r.Width * j, r.Y + r.Height * i, r.Width, r.Height)))
|
||||
End If
|
||||
End If
|
||||
|
||||
Next
|
||||
Next
|
||||
End If
|
||||
|
|
Loading…
Reference in New Issue